They Want to Save the Night Trains: "It's Such a Long Country - It Has to Work"

Summary by Svt Nyheter
In recent days, protests have been organized against the closure of night trains across Europe. In Umeå, people are protesting against the closure of the night train from Umeå to Gothenburg and the halving of the night trains between Stockholm and Kiruna. “We have such a long country and we need a functioning traffic system that does not emit so many toxins,” says Åsa Karlberg.
